What is the difference between Low Volatility and High Volatility slots?

Low Volatility slots yield frequent, smaller payout combinations that maintain bankroll equilibrium during extended play sessions. High Volatility slots experience longer non-winning spin sequences (drought intervals) punctuated by rare, high-multiplier scatter events.
